Google Drive


You can import Google Drive files into Brightspot. This integration is helpful for editors who want to import their Google Drive Files into the same context they use to publish content. Brightspot supports the import of the following Google Drive files:

  • Google Doc—Can be imported into Brightspot as an article, a blog post, a document, or as a general digital attachment.
  • Google Sheet—Can be imported into Brightspot as sections, tags, users, or as a general digital attachment.

Once imported, Brightspot checks the source file to detect any changes made after the import. If changes are made, Brightspot indicates this in the Sync widget of a content type created as a result of the import. (For details, see Re-syncing a Google Drive file.) If no changes are detected, Brightspot reports that the source file and the Brightspot content type are in sync.
